Introduction:
Artificial Intelligence (AI) has the potential to transform the healthcare industry, offering
advanced tools and capabilities for diagnosis, treatment, and patient care. This
document examines the benefits and risks associated with the integration of AI in
healthcare.
c. Predictive Analytics and Early Intervention: AI can identify patterns and trends in
patient data, enabling early detection of diseases and prediction of potential health
risks. This proactive approach facilitates timely interventions and preventive measures,
improving patient outcomes.
a. Data Privacy and Security: AI in healthcare relies on vast amounts of sensitive patient
data, raising concerns about privacy and security. Safeguarding patient information and
ensuring compliance with data protection regulations is essential to maintain trust and
protect against potential data breaches.
b. Bias and Discrimination: AI algorithms are only as unbiased as the data they are
trained on. If training data contains inherent biases, AI systems can perpetuate or
amplify those biases. It is crucial to address and mitigate biases to ensure fair and
equitable healthcare delivery.
a. Transparent and Explainable AI: To gain trust and acceptance, AI systems in healthcare
should be transparent and explainable, providing clear insights into how decisions are
made. Explainable AI enables healthcare professionals to understand and interpret AI-
generated recommendations.
